Abstract/Contents: | "Anaerobic soils limit the amount of free oxygen available in the root zone and hence will impede root development and restrain nutrient availability for turf growth. An on-range study was conducted on existing greens to investigate the influence of CO₂ content in the root zone on turf quality. Nine greens were monitored periodically since August 1998. On each green, five 1 m diameter circular plots were randomly selected for conducting the experiment. Data collected from each plot included turf quality, CO₂ content, and physical and chemical properties of the rooting mixtures. Results revealed that CO₂ content in the root zone increased as water content increased. Results also showed that turf quality declined when CO₂ content reached above 5% in the summer season. Cultivation could initially increase oxygen in the root zone, but the benefits decreased with time." |
